Dimensions :
Height: 135cm (including filter bottle)
Width: 32cm
Depth 35cm

Features:
7 Stage filtration System
Chilled Water Tap
Hot Water Tap
Removable Drip Tray
On / Off Switches for both Chilled and Hot Water
LED Display
Including Storage Cabinet

This floor standing water cooler is a modern design and will fit perfectly into your home or business. It is fitted with a filtration bottle including a 7-stage filter cartridge so you never will have to buy bottled water again. Just fill the filter bottle with your own tap water and our filtration system will purify and filter the water. Now you can enjoy clean water made from your own tap for free. You can refill the bottle as often as you like, just replace the filter cartridge every 6 - 12 months. Prices on filter changes: replacement cartridge. How much water do you have to drink per day?

The Society for Nutrition recommends that adults drink a minimum of one and a half litres of water per day. Other studies recommend between two and three litres of water a day. In extreme heat or cold, as well as illnesses such as fever, vomiting and diarrhea, the body needs a lot of fluids. Even with physical exertion such as sports or physical work, you must make sure that you drink enough water. You can determine how much you should really drink with a simple rule of thumb:

Kilograms of body weight x 35 ml of water = recommended amount to drink per day
